AI Contract Overview
The contract involves the supply of Guldmann Basic High Slings designed for ceiling-mounted patient lifts used at the Michael E. DeBakey VA Medical Center in Houston. These slings are intended to adhere to safe patient handling standards and must be fully compatible with the current lift systems in place, ensuring seamless integration into clinical operations. The procurement falls under the NAICS code 314994 and is managed by the Department of Veterans Affairs through the 256-NETWORK Contract Office 16. Issued as a subcontract opportunity, the solicitation was posted on May 21, 2026, with a submission deadline of May 27, 2026. The place of performance is specified as Houston, Texas, with a ZIP code of 77030. This contract supports the medical facility’s mission to provide safe and efficient patient handling solutions by securing high-quality, reliable sling equipment compatible with existing patient lift infrastructure.
